Sorry for the late response. I didn't even know we had a forum until Shiv sprung it on me yesterday.

We are currently testing our Garrett based ball bearing turbo on the STi. I can't release any numbers yet, but I should have more info in a couple of weeks. We will also be testing a 3037 if the 2.5 proves robust enough.

The Sti hasn't taken back seat to the Evo, the Evo has just been easier to upgrade due to the availability of parts such as injectors and cams. The STi stages are just going to take a little longer.

Please be patient....good things will come!

Our stage 2 sti is a turbo, injectors and fuel pump on top of the stage 1(turboback exhaust and xede) for the STi. The kit utilizes an FP turbo.
